General description

VEGF-D, also known as Vascular Endothelial Growth Factor D, or c-Fos-induced growth factor, FIGF, and encoded by the gene FIGF/VEGFD, is one of a family of vascular growth factors that is active in angiogenesis, lymphangiogenesis and endothelial cell growth. VEGF-D functions during the formation of venous and lymphatic vascular systems and is critical for their maintenance during adulthood. VEGF-D, originally discovered as a c-Fos induced growth factor (FIGF), is developmentally regulated by c-Fos and expressed in a variety of tissues and organs including limb buds, acoustic ganglion, teeth, heart, anterior pituitary as well as lung and kidney mesenchyme, liver, derma, and periosteum of the vertebral column. Because of its role in lymphangiogenesis VEGFD is also a key therapeutic target to modulate metastasis, and recent research demonstrates that VEGFD-MEK-ERK signaling modulates SOX18-mediated transcription in normal cells and thus various pathologies maybe because of a dysregulation of SOXF-mediated transcriptional networks.
~57 kDa observed. The calculated molecular weight is 40 kDa, however VEGF-D has been shown as a ~57 to ~58 kDa band in western blots (Liu Y.H., et al., (2008) J Immunol. 81(9):6584-94).
